The Shift Toward Digital Rewards in New Zealand Business Culture
Recent data indicates that approximately 68% of New Zealand companies have integrated some form of digital reward system into their operations, reflecting an industry-wide acknowledgment of its efficacy. Digital rewards offer flexibility, immediate recognition, and broader appeal—traits that resonate with a workforce increasingly accustomed to instant gratification.
Leading global firms operating in New Zealand, such as Xero and Fisher & Paykel, demonstrate the advantages of invested reward ecosystems. These programs not only boost morale but also streamline administrative overhead, allowing HR teams to focus on strategic initiatives.

Strategic Considerations for Implementing Digital Rewards in Your Organization
| Key Aspect | Best Practice | Impact |
|---|---|---|
| Personalization | Utilize data analytics to customize rewards based on individual preferences. | Higher engagement and perceived value. |
| Integration | Ensure seamless integration with existing HR and payroll systems. | Smoother administration and real-time tracking. |
| Transparency | Maintain clear communication regarding reward criteria and redemption processes. | Builds trust and encourages participation. |
| Sustainability | Incorporate environmentally conscious options into reward choices. | Aligns with Maori and wider New Zealand cultural values. |
